《雨月》(1953 年)是一部經典日本電影,由溝口健二執導,改編自上田秋成的 18 世紀靈異故事和莫泊桑的短篇小說。故事背景為 16 世紀末的內戰,講述了兩個野心勃勃的男人因貪婪和慾望而導致他們和他們的家人陷入悲劇的故事。
陶工源十郎夢想致富,而他的朋友藤兵衛則渴望成為武士。當他們的村莊陷入戰爭混亂時,他們前往城市出售陶器。源十郎遇見了神秘的貴婦若狹夫人,並被引誘與她同住,但他並不知道她是個鬼魂。同時,藤兵衛拋棄了他的妻子,去追求他的武士夢想,最終獲得了盔甲和作為一名武士的虛假名聲。
源十郎發現了若狹夫人的真相,僥倖逃脫了她鬼魂的控制,回到家中後發現妻子宮城已被士兵殺害。藤兵衛在獲得短暫的成功後,發現他的妻子大濱被迫賣淫。他深感沮喪,發誓要改過自新。
溝口健二的導演風格以其標誌性的長鏡頭和流暢的鏡頭運動增強了影片的詩意和夢幻氛圍。現實主義與超自然主義的融合凸顯了野心、幻想和人類愚蠢的主題。影片批判了戰爭的破壞性和不受約束的野心,揭示了人們的慾望如何蒙蔽了人們的雙眼,使他們看不清現實。
《雨月》仍然是電影史上最偉大的成就之一,因其令人難忘的美感、情感深度和微妙的女性主義主題而受到稱讚。它贏得了威尼斯電影節銀獅獎並影響了世界各地的電影製作人。其幽靈般的優雅和悲劇的敘事使其成為日本電影的不朽傑作。
Ugetsu (1953) is a classic Japanese film directed by Kenji Mizoguchi, based on Ueda Akinari’s 18th-century supernatural tales and Guy de Maupassant’s short stories. Set during the late 16th-century civil wars, it follows two ambitious men whose greed and desires lead them and their families to tragedy.
Genjurō, a potter, dreams of wealth, while his friend Tōbei longs to become a samurai. When their village is caught in the chaos of war, they travel to a city to sell pottery. Genjurō meets Lady Wakasa, a mysterious noblewoman, and is seduced into staying with her, unaware that she is a ghost. Meanwhile, Tōbei abandons his wife to pursue his samurai ambitions, eventually acquiring armor and a false reputation as a warrior.
Genjurō discovers the truth about Lady Wakasa and barely escapes her spirit’s grasp, returning home to find that his wife, Miyagi, was killed by soldiers. Tōbei, having gained fleeting success, realizes his wife, Ohama, has been forced into prostitution. Devastated, he vows to reform.
Mizoguchi’s direction, with his signature long takes and fluid camera movements, enhances the film’s poetic and dreamlike atmosphere. The blending of realism and the supernatural underscores themes of ambition, illusion, and human folly. The film critiques the destructive nature of war and unchecked ambition, showing how people’s desires blind them to reality.
Ugetsu remains one of cinema’s greatest achievements, praised for its haunting beauty, emotional depth, and subtle feminist themes. It won the Silver Lion at the Venice Film Festival and influenced filmmakers worldwide. Its ghostly elegance and tragic storytelling make it an enduring masterpiece of Japanese cinema.
